Comprehending Foggy Windows
Foggy windows are a result of a failed seal in insulated glass units (IGUs). IGUs are created to have two or more layers of glass with a sealed space in between them, often filled with air or a worthy gas like argon. This design supplies insulation and minimizes heat transfer, making the windows more energy-efficient. However, if the seal between the glass layers breaks, wetness can permeate in, leading to a foggy window Repair appearance and lowered performance.
